We had the 55dba version of this in our apartment. A slightly more step up (would recommend spending the extra $50 for that one). Out of the budget GE and Whirlpool models I've had at apartments I was extremely impressed how well it would clean with just simple Great Value Powder. Living in college we abused it never prewashed dishes, ran it every day. Yet came out perfectly clear sometimes some mild stains but nothing crazy. Worked the 3 years we were there. Drying is a challenge despite heat dry but we didn't use Jet Dry and ceramic plates and glasses would be bone dry. Just plastics were wet

Eventually moved to my own home have a high end LG now but for $350 it's a great dishwasher for a rental

$200+ for install, $50 for haul away, and $100 more for 3 year warranty. At that point you are better off getting a better unit from Costco.

This ends up being $615 before tax on a $400ish msrp dishwasher, where at Costco I'm looking at $740 for a $1000 msrp Whirlpool with a 5 year total warranty.
